Abstract

The invention relates to fireproof flannelette shell fabric capable of effectively preventing fabric from catching fire. The fireproof flannelette shell fabric comprises a spandex flannelette shell fabric body (1), wherein an anti-radiation layer (2) is arranged on the upper surface of the spandex flannelette shell fabric body; a wear-resistant layer (4) is arranged on the upper surface of the anti-radiation layer; and an antibacterial layer, a fireproof layer, a waterproof layer and a close fitting layer are sequentially arranged on the lower surface of the spandex flannelette shell fabric body. A lining fabric layer is arranged on the back of the close fitting layer and comprises warp yarns and weft yarns which are mutually interlaced; velveteen is interlaced between the warp yarns and the weft yarns; the warp yarns and the weft yarns are made from carbon fibers; the velveteen is made from cotton yarns; and a flame-retardant layer, a waterproof layer and an anti-static layer are arranged on the velveteen from inside to outside. The fireproof flannelette shell fabric has stereoscopic sensation and the functions of bacterium prevention, radiation resistance, fire prevention, water resistance, wear resistance and the like and is capable of effectively preventing the fabric from catching fire.
